VFW Retires Worn Flags

They served their nation well and were retired with dignity and honor.VFW Post 7305 held an official retirement ceremony for worn or damaged United States flags on Saturday, May 4. The ceremony was held in the Lake Beckwith parking lot, near the LTC. Fred A. Ettleman Post 7305.

Seven Rye High School Students Earn $1,000 Scholarships from San Isabel Electric

This year's San Isabel Electric scholarship applicants have shattered previous records. The notfor- profit electric cooperative collected 73 complete applications, nearly double the number in recent years.

Rye Elementary Participated in Successful Pilot Program

During the April 23 Pueblo County School District 70 (D70) Board of Education (BOE) meeting, Dr. Anthony Martinez, Director of Curriculum and Instruction for D70, shared that a Literacy Pilot Program had been declared successful.

Juniors Shine at Achievement Award Ceremony

The Masonic Lodge, Eastern Star Chapter, and Order of Amaranth of Pueblo County once again recognized fourteen Outstanding Junior Achievement Award recipients. From each of the seven public high schools in the Pueblo County area, a boy and girl are selected to receive this honor each year.

Liberty Quartet Scheduled at Valley Community Church

For the third consecutive year, Valley Community Church will host the Liberty Quartet on Friday, May 17, beginning at 6:00 p.m. Valley Community Church is located at 4253 Mercantile St., in Colorado City. Admission to the concert is free and a love offering will be received.

Pueblo County Sheriff ’s Office Honors Telecommunicators

National Public Safety Telecommunicators Week, is when we honor the hard-working invisible professionals who answer 911 calls and dispatch police, firefighters, and paramedics to assist us during emergencies.
